Kim Kardashian Gets Pampered, Talks Stalker

Making time for some pampering, Kim Kardashian was spotted leaving a local nail salon in Los Angeles, California on Monday (August 2).

Dressed in a cute and casual get-up, the “Keeping Up With the Kardashians” gal paid little attention to the media and was careful not to smudge her freshly painted nails as she made her way to her vehicle.


On a serious note, Ms Kardashian is taking extra measures to ensure she and footballer beau, Miles Austin, are safe from a man that has been stalking the reality TV star.

Dennis Shaun Bowman, who already has a restraining order on him from Kim, has been over-stepping his boundaries by sending Twitter messages to Miles and Kim’s sister, Khloe.

The beautiful brunette’s lawyer, Shawn Chapman Holley, told TMZ, “I will be speaking with law enforcement detectives [to] determine whether or not Mr. Bowman’s actions are a violation of the order in place restricting Mr. Bowman’s conduct toward Ms. Kardashian.”

Nicole Richie DUI Probation Terminated Early

Nicole Richie's probation was terminated this morning -- months before it was scheduled to end ... TMZ has learned.

Nicole was on probation for a DUI in 2006, where she was driving the wrong way on an L.A. freeway.

Nicole's lawyer, the effervescent Shawn Chapman Holley, went to court this AM -- in the rain no less -- and presented the judge with proof Nicole had completed all the terms of probation, including a glowing report from the alcohol ed program in which she's been enrolled for the last 18 months.

Probation was scheduled to end in February, but since all the terms have been satisfied, the judge agreed to terminate it early.

So Mrs. Madden starts the New Year as a married but free woman.

Police: Lindsay Lohan Committed Battery

Police now assert the actress did, in fact, commit battery against a Betty Ford employee in a Dec. 12 scuffle – and plan to hand the case over to local prosecutors for review.

"The investigation determined Ms. Lohan violated several aspects of her probation, including the battery [charge]," the Palm Desert Police Department said in a press release Monday, adding that they plan to notify Lohan's probation officer.

Lohan's attorney, Shawn Chapman Holley, wasn't immediately available for comment. Lohan, 24, was released from rehab Monday and faces a routine Feb. 25 progress review hearing.

L.A. Superior Court Judge Elden Fox previously warned Lohan that any more slip-ups would be met with six months in jail. As of Tuesday, however, the court still hadn't received formal notice of the incident.

Betty Ford employee Dawn Holland was fired the same day she went public with claims that Lohan threw a phone at her and yanked another phone out of her hand, causing a sprain after a confrontation at the famed Rancho Mirage, Calif., clinic.

Holland stated that Lohan was acting "out of control" and had alcohol on her breath and refused to take a Breathalyzer test when she was caught coming home past curfew.

Police continued their investigation despite Holland's decision to recant her claims, with her attorney stating that Holland, a former addict herself, had no desire to see Lohan prosecuted.

Lindsay Lohan Snuck Out of Rehab for Alcohol

An employee of the clinic went public Tuesday with claims the actress was "out of control" and had alcohol on her breath during a tussle between them on Dec. 12.

Dawn Holland, a chemical technician at the desert rehab facility, gave her account in a video interview with TMZ, which included a copy of her report on the incident.

Within minutes of the story posting, Holland was fired.

"Regrettably," the Betty Ford Center said in a statement, "one of our employees violated strict confidentiality guidelines and laws by publically identifying patients in a media interview and by disclosing a privileged document."

According to Holland, Lohan and two other patients had "snuck out" and "went drinking," but were caught by another technician when they were "trying to jump over the back wall" to the clinic house in which they were living.

Holland was then called to administer Breathalyzer tests to the three patients when trouble erupted between her and a foul-mouthed Lohan, she says. "She was very angry and out of control," says Holland.

Police were called, and while Holland was on the phone with authorities, Lohan "grabbed my wrist and snatched it down" to try to wrest away the phone, sending Holland to the emergency room with a sprained right arm and hand, she says. Holland says she's now on worker's compensation leave.

Throughout the night, Lohan refused to submit to a Breathalyzer test and had apparently been drinking. "She had alcohol on her breath," says Holland, who denies being the aggressor. "I did not touch the woman," she says. "I am not willing to risk my job over any patient."
